This paper extends previous results by the same authors et al. [ibid. 191, No. 45, 5177--5206 (2002; Zbl 1083.74583)] in order to model consistently through-thickness effects (thickness change and linear variations of thickness stretch) in the approximation of shells. Various benchmark tests including geometric, material and contact nonlinearities are carried out to assess the performance of the method. It is shown that the developed shell element can be successfully applied to general nonlinear applications for thin or thick shells, without thickness locking.
